I have an old 91 invader ski/fishing boat that needs some serious restoration, the leather is all waterlogged and cracked up from sitting outdoors for so many years with no cover, all the chrome is tanished and old looking . The fiberglass is dull and needs a good polish. Are any of these things a DIY job? I'm thinking of trying to figure out how to polish the gelcoat in the outside myself, for interior I might have to find a professional.

for the upholstery if you are crafty and good with a sewing machine, marine grade vinyl is relatively inexpensive and you can recover your own seats. There are some good restoration polishes out there, buy a good buffing wheel and you can get the gel coat looking good again.
